Transaction

6170ee6e2604f367c2fb1ce66bad00abc3436b8a3cc4e8a63379b8d9f82abd10
443,404 confirmations
Timestamp
1508630729
Block491,045
Fee2,438,040 sats
Fee rate54.9 sats/vB
view on mempool.space

Inputs & Outputs

Inputs